产品研发流程标准化操作规范_第1页
产品研发流程标准化操作规范_第2页
产品研发流程标准化操作规范_第3页
产品研发流程标准化操作规范_第4页
产品研发流程标准化操作规范_第5页
已阅读5页,还剩5页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

产品研发流程标准化操作规范一、适用范围与场景描述本规范适用于企业内所有新产品研发项目、现有产品功能迭代升级、技术架构优化等研发场景,旨在统一研发流程标准,明确各阶段职责分工,提升研发效率与产品质量,降低项目风险。无论是独立项目还是跨部门协作项目,均需遵循本规范执行,保证研发活动有序推进。二、核心流程分阶段操作说明(一)需求分析阶段:明确方向,锁定目标目标:全面收集、分析并确认用户需求与业务价值,形成可执行的需求基线,避免后期需求频繁变更。输入:市场调研数据、用户反馈、竞品分析报告、业务部门诉求。输出:《需求分析报告》、需求基线文档。负责人:产品经理、需求分析师、市场调研专员*。操作步骤:需求收集通过用户访谈、问卷调研、焦点小组、行业报告分析等方式,收集用户痛点和业务需求;整理内部需求池,包括销售反馈、客服问题、技术优化建议等,标注需求来源与初步优先级。需求分析对收集的需求进行分类(功能需求、非功能需求、数据需求等),剔除重复或模糊需求;通过MoSCoW法则(必须有、应该有、可以有、暂不需要)对需求优先级排序,评估需求对业务目标的贡献度;分析需求的技术可行性、资源投入与周期,形成需求可行性分析报告。需求评审组织需求评审会,参会人员包括产品经理、技术负责人、测试负责人、业务部门代表;逐项讲解需求内容,确认需求的完整性、一致性与可理解性,记录评审意见并达成共识;输出《需求评审纪要》,明确需求基线,经各方签字确认后冻结需求(重大变更需重新走评审流程)。(二)项目立项阶段:资源统筹,目标对齐目标:明确项目目标、范围、资源与计划,获得管理层批准,正式启动项目。输入:《需求分析报告》、可行性分析报告。输出:《项目立项申请书》、项目章程。负责人:产品经理、项目经理、技术负责人、财务专员。操作步骤:立项申请填写《项目立项申请书》,明确项目名称、目标、核心功能范围、预期成果、时间周期、预算(含人力、硬件、外包等成本);附《需求分析报告》《技术可行性方案》《风险评估报告》等支撑材料。立项评审组织公司级立项评审会,参会人员包括研发总监、产品总监、财务负责人、业务负责人;从市场价值、技术可行性、投入产出比、风险控制等维度评估项目,形成评审意见。立项审批评审通过后,由研发总监签发《项目章程》,明确项目经理、项目团队组成、核心目标、里程碑节点及考核标准;正式立项,项目进入计划阶段,资源同步分配到位。(三)方案设计阶段:架构先行,细节落地目标:完成产品技术方案与UI/UX设计,保证设计满足需求且具备可开发性。输入:《项目章程》、需求基线文档。输出:《技术设计方案》《UI/UX设计稿》《原型评审报告》。负责人:技术负责人、架构师、UI设计师、UX设计师。操作步骤:技术方案设计架构师*牵头进行技术选型(编程语言、框架、数据库、中间件等),设计系统架构图(如微服务架构、分层架构),明确核心模块与接口;输出《技术设计方案》,包含架构说明、模块划分、接口定义、数据结构、安全策略、功能优化方案等。UI/UX设计UX设计师*根据需求文档设计用户流程图、信息架构图,输出线框图(低保真原型);UI设计师*基于线框图设计高保真视觉稿,包括界面布局、配色方案、交互效果、图标规范等;组织内部评审,保证设计符合用户体验标准与品牌调性。方案评审联合产品、技术、测试团队召开设计方案评审会,重点评审技术方案的合理性、接口的兼容性、UI/UX的易用性;输出《方案评审报告》,对评审意见进行整改,最终确认设计方案并冻结(重大调整需重新评审)。(四)开发实现阶段:编码规范,进度可控目标:按设计方案完成代码开发,保证代码质量与功能实现一致性。输入:《技术设计方案》《UI/UX设计稿》。输出:可测试的软件版本、开发文档、代码库。负责人:项目经理、开发负责人、开发工程师*。操作步骤:任务拆解与排期开发负责人将模块拆分为具体开发任务,分配至开发工程师,明确任务描述、交付标准与截止时间;制定《项目开发计划表》,细化到每日任务,同步至项目管理工具(如Jira、Teambition)。编码开发开发工程师*遵循公司《代码开发规范》(命名规范、注释规范、代码结构等)进行编码;每日站会同步进度(15分钟内),说明昨日完成、今日计划、遇到的问题,项目经理*协调资源解决阻塞;使用Git进行版本控制,遵循分支管理策略(如GitFlow),定期提交代码并提交合并请求(MR)。代码评审开发工程师完成模块开发后,提交MR,由至少1名同级别或高级开发工程师进行代码评审;评审重点:代码逻辑正确性、功能优化点、异常处理、安全性、可维护性,对问题点及时修复;评审通过后,代码合并至开发分支,集成至测试环境。(五)测试验证阶段:质量保障,缺陷闭环目标:通过全面测试发觉并修复缺陷,保证产品满足质量标准后上线。输入:开发完成的软件版本、《需求文档》《技术设计方案》。输出:《测试计划》《测试用例》《测试报告》、缺陷清单。负责人:测试负责人、测试工程师、开发工程师*。操作步骤:测试准备测试负责人*制定《测试计划》,明确测试范围、测试策略(功能测试、功能测试、安全测试、兼容性测试等)、测试资源、时间节点;测试工程师*根据需求文档与设计稿编写《测试用例》,覆盖核心功能、边界条件、异常场景,用例需通过评审。测试执行执行功能测试,用例通过率需达95%以上,对发觉的缺陷提交至缺陷管理系统(如Jira),明确缺陷等级(致命/严重/一般/轻微)、复现步骤、预期结果;开发工程师在24小时内响应缺陷,修复后提交回归测试,测试工程师验证修复结果,直至缺陷关闭;开展功能测试(如压力测试、并发测试)、安全测试(漏洞扫描、渗透测试),保证系统稳定性与安全性。测试报告测试阶段结束后,输出《测试报告》,包含测试范围、用例执行情况、缺陷统计、遗留问题及风险、测试结论(通过/不通过/有条件通过);若测试通过,出具《测试准出报告》;若存在遗留缺陷,需评估风险,经产品经理、研发负责人确认后,明确上线条件与修复计划。(六)发布上线阶段:平滑过渡,监控到位目标:安全、高效地将产品发布至生产环境,保证用户可正常使用。输入:《测试准出报告》、生产环境准备清单。输出:线上可用版本、发布报告、上线监控数据。负责人:运维工程师、项目经理、产品经理、技术负责人。操作步骤:发布准备运维工程师*准备生产环境(服务器部署、数据库配置、网络配置、域名解析等),执行数据备份(全量+增量);制定《发布方案》,明确发布时间窗口(如凌晨低峰期)、回滚方案、人员分工(操作人、审核人、监控人);组织发布前预演,验证部署脚本与回滚流程的可靠性。正式发布按发布方案执行部署,逐步切换流量(如灰度发布:先10%流量,观察30分钟无异常后逐步提升至100%);发布过程中,实时监控系统状态(CPU、内存、接口响应时间、错误率),若出现异常立即触发回滚。上线后验证产品经理、测试工程师验证核心功能线上可用性,确认业务数据正常;收集用户反馈,监控线上日志,及时处理突发问题;输出《发布报告》,记录发布时间、版本号、发布内容、问题处理情况,同步至相关方。(七)复盘优化阶段:总结经验,持续改进目标:复盘项目全流程,总结成功经验与待改进点,形成标准化沉淀,提升后续研发效率。输入:项目各阶段文档、发布报告、用户反馈数据。输出:《项目复盘报告》、改进措施清单。负责人:项目经理、产品经理、技术负责人、测试负责人。操作步骤:数据收集整理项目过程中的关键数据:需求变更次数、开发周期、测试通过率、线上缺陷数、用户满意度等;收集团队成员反馈(通过问卷或访谈),包括流程中的痛点、协作问题、资源瓶颈等。复盘会议组织项目复盘会,参会人员包括项目核心团队、相关业务部门代表*;从“目标达成情况、流程执行有效性、团队协作效率、风险控制效果”等维度展开讨论,分析成功经验与未达预期的原因。输出改进措施形成《项目复盘报告》,明确改进项(如“需求评审环节增加用户代表参与”“优化代码评审流程缩短周期”)、责任人与完成时间;将标准化经验(如模板、流程优化点)沉淀至公司知识库,更新至相关规范文档,形成持续改进机制。三、关键流程模板工具包(一)需求分析模板需求编号需求名称需求来源(用户/市场/内部)需求描述(详细说明用户场景、痛点)优先级(P0-P3)预估工时/成本负责人状态(待分析/分析中/已评审/已驳回)备注R-001用户登录功能优化用户反馈老用户登录频繁验证码,体验差P1(必须有)15人日/8万元*已评审增加记住密码功能(二)项目立项模板项目名称项目目标(SMART原则)项目周期项目预算(万元)核心功能范围简述风险评估(技术/资源/市场)申请人评审结论智能客服系统V2.03个月内上线,支持文本+语音交互,客服响应时长≤30秒2024.06-2024.0950多轮对话、工单转接、知识库管理技术难点:语音识别准确率;资源:算法工程师短缺*通过(三)缺陷跟踪模板缺陷ID缺陷标题所属模块严重等级(致命/严重/一般/轻微)复现步骤(1.2.3…)预期结果实际结果责任人状态(新建/处理中/已修复/已验证/已关闭)提交时间B-005订单支付失败支付模块严重1.选择优惠券2.支付3.跳转支付页支付页正常显示支付页空白*已验证2024-05-10(四)项目复盘报告模板项目名称复盘周期核心成员目标达成情况(对比立项目标)流程亮点(如需求评审提前减少变更)流程不足(如测试环境不稳定导致延期)改进措施(如提前3天准备测试环境)责任人完成时间移动APPV3.02024.01-2024.04、、*用户满意度85%(目标90%)需求阶段引入用户代表,变更率降低20%测试环境多次宕机,延期5天运维团队提前1周准备测试环境,增加监控赵六*2024-05-20四、执行过程中的关键保障要点(一)需求变更管理需求变更需提交《需求变更申请单》,说明变更原因、内容、影响范围(对进度、成本、技术的冲击);组织变更评审会(产品、技术、测试、项目经理),评估变更必要性,审批通过后更新需求基线,同步调整项目计划;严禁未经审批的“口头变更”或“私下修改”,避免需求蔓延。(二)跨部门协作机制建立“周例会+日报”沟通机制:项目组每周一召开进度会,每日下班前提交日报(完成事项、问题、明日计划);明确接口人:产品与技术接口为产品经理,技术与测试接口为测试负责人,问题升级时由项目经理*协调资源;使用统一协作工具(如飞书、钉钉),保证信息同步透明,减少沟通成本。(三)文档规范与归档各阶段输出文档需及时归档至公司知识库(如Confluence),命名规范为“项目名-阶段-版本-日期”(如“智能客服V2.0-需求分析-V1.0-20240510”);文档内容需完整、准确,关键数据(如需求基线、技术方案)需经负责人签字确认,避免责任不清;项目结束后,输出《项目文档清单》,保证所有文档可追溯。(四)风险控制与应急预案项目启动前识别潜在风险(技术风险、资源风险、市场风险),制定《风险登记表》,明确风险描述、等级、应对措施、责任人;关键风险(如核心技术难点)需提前进行技术预研,验证可行性;制定

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

最新文档

评论

0/150

提交评论